CD Text Oddity

It’s probably the least important thing ever, but I found if you have all empty Performer fields in the CD Text in Wavelab, Wavelab will also make the fields empty on the CD and DDP, as expected. But if you have some Performer fields empty, some not empty, Wavelab will add a space character to the empty ones on the CD and DDP. I think it’s probably been this way forever, so I’m not going to worry about it too much, but I wonder if this is common. I think it’s the same for the other CD Text fields too. I don’t think it adversely affects display, at least in any players I’ve tried.

Would be time consuming to check this, but this is certainly a consequence of the CD-Text encoding, ie. the way the CD Text is stored on the CD.
